The MissionMake maintaining software as easy as writing it.
The ProblemDevelopers spend as much as 85% of their time on non-coding tasks like answering questions, triaging issues, reviewing code, and writing documentation.
The ProductTo start, we built Dosu as an AI teammate that acts as a first line of defense for ad-hoc engineering requests and incoming issues. Dosu is now the most popular bot for maintaining OSS projects and internal services. It is used by tens of thousands of developers every month.
Next, we are transforming Dosu into a living knowledge-base for software teams. With Dosu developers get the complete, up-to-date docs they’ve always needed.
The NumbersWe’re looking for a Senior Product Designer with experience in developer tools and AI-powered products to design Dosu’s core user experience. You’ll design across the product surface, everything from first-time use and search to structured editing and AI-generated workflows.
You’ll collaborate closely with engineering, product, and customers to identify high-leverage design opportunities and deliver elegant, developer-friendly solutions.
What You'll DoInterviewing is hard. We aim to keep the interview process relatively succinct (1-3 weeks end-to-end), topical to what you’d be working on at Dosu, and—as much as possible—enjoyable.
1. Intro Call (30 minutes / Google Meet)A casual video call to:
We’ll walk through a few of your past projects together. We’re looking to understand how you think, how you approach design problems, and how you collaborate with engineering and product.
3. Live Design Challenge – Interactive (45 minutes / Google Meet)Instead of a take-home assignment, we’ll do a live design session. You’ll be given a realistic product design task (e.g., designing a UI for an AI-assisted developer workflow) and asked to work through it live while we observe and collaborate. The goal isn’t perfection—it’s to understand your process, how you break down problems, and how you make design decisions in real-time. We’ll debrief together afterward.
4. Onsite (3 hours / In-Person)Visit our office at 1841 Market St in San Francisco. You’ll meet the team, discuss the future of the product, and chat through how we work together day-to-day. Expect a mix of product deep dives, system thinking, and team culture conversations.
Interested?Please include your portfolio, resume, and a brief note about why you're excited to design developer tools at Dosu. We’d love to see a case study and or portfolio that demonstrates your process and thinking. Including links to personal creative projects is encouraged. Show us who you are and what you like to do!
